After hearing a couple success stories, I decided to jump on the bandwagon with 5 math problems. I will be giving Haley the five hardest problems from her problem set each day. If she gets them all correct, she is done with math for the day. So far, it is working very well. Even if she misses one or two, she is working much more carefully and neatly.
